Moving-Up Nostalgia

To the Editor,

Hello from the other side of the Earth, and thank you for the coverage of the 8th Grade Moving-up Ceremony in the 16 June issue. I must confess to serious nostalgia, as I was a member of the first official Moving-up Ceremony in 1975.

It’s quite terrifying to think that what was started in that long-ago year by Jack Lynch is now considered a “tradition” – I am certain that he would be pleased to think that his idea of elevating the achievements of the entire group of students, as well as diminishing the fears of moving to the Big School, had been carried on this long. The photographs of the students look quite a bit more mature than I remember at that age, but surely that must be the nature of growing older.

I wish all those bright young faces the best of luck in the coming four years.

Best Regards,

Nikki Buxton

Stanley, Falkland Islands                                            June 26, 2000
